Then it doesn't work at best... I changed everything in the broadcasting procedure: * changed format to mp3. In the future I will think about two streams: one 64kbps (sechyas 96) mp3 -- low quality and one 96kbps ogg -- high. * now AyEmul does not connect directly to the codec, but is first encoded to mp3 files - which makes it possible to have everything played in mp3 form for the last hour and possibly in the future provide RSS links to these files (for downloading in the form of files). * refused to use a windows machine - it was not stable, that's all time rebooted (perhaps “does not play” is not due at all to codecs but with the fact that it still plays, but there is silence...) AyEmul runs under wine. * refused at the same time from esound. I'm looking towards PulseAudio - it's for work not Requires a physical sound card in the computer. * now it is possible to display the currently playing module (http://mercury.probapribor.spb.ru:8000 - below is the line "current song").* a silece detector is clearly needed, because many AY modules are crammed with silence (at the end) for 1, 3, even 10 minutes, which is completely unacceptable. Until then cut off the silence with sox. This, by the way, is another and most significant reason (again nik-o and a 5-minute pause...) for which direct playback Ay_Emul --> internet is a stupid idea. * some kind of “effects processor” is needed to replace the stupid ABC with stereo.
